Try using a lightbox if you think you have SAD

wishuponastar

It's a bit of an investment, so you might want to try and get extra light in other ways, but using a light box has been shown to lift the mood of some percentage of people who experience Seasonal Affective Disorder.

You need to sit a certain distance from the light for a certain period of time, ideally in the morning.
